Released in 1993 by the noted audiophile label Chesky Records, Dancing In The Dark is a remarkable exploration of the Great American Songbook by the Fred Hersch Trio. Originally a classically trained pianist from Cincinnati, Ohio, Hersch made his mark in New York City in the 1980s when he played with jazz legends Chris Connor and Joe Henderson. After debuting for Chesky Records in 1991 with a quintet record called Forward Motion, he downsized his band to a trio for Dancing In The Dark. Teaming up with bassist Drew Gress and drummer Tom Rainey, Hersch offered spectacular new treatments of timeless tunes such as ‘I Fall In Love Too Easily,’ ‘For All We Know,’ and ‘My Funny Valentine.’ With their near-telepathic interplay, the trio offered new perspectives on well-worn evergreens, showing how jazz and its improvisational ethos could take familiar melodies and harmonic frameworks and transform them into new and exciting aural adventures. Rewarded with a Grammy® nomination, Dancing In The Dark remains one of the essential, go-to records in both Hersch’s and Chesky’s back catalog. The album is reissued on SACD Hybrid Stereo and will be released on 19 September 2025.

Portraits Of Cuba reflects the musical odyssey of Paquito D’Rivera, a unique blend of Cuban and Jazz music that re-affirms both the artist's Cuban roots and his love for the American art form. Far beyond the realm of popular music, it is a jazz musicians's tribute to the enduring legacy of Cuba, beautifully orchestrated by arranger and conductor Carlos Franzetti and impeccably performed by Mr. D'Rivera and eighteen seasoned musicians, each with a proven track record of excellence. A landmark 2004 album by Marta Gómez that established her as one of Latin America’s most poetic voices. The recording unites Colombian folk traditions with Latin American rhythms, Spanish flamenco, and jazz harmony across fourteen tracks—twelve of them original—that travel from the valleys of Colombia to the coasts of Peru and beyond.
